Catalyst: We are a specialist consulting firm working exclusively in financial services. 2019 marks our 25th anniversary bringing business,...
Location: Saint Helier , Channel Islands
Language(s): Only English Required
Date Added: 16 Dec 2020
Language(s): Only English Required
Date Added: 16 Dec 2020